F-105D Hill AFB Skins
Semi Historical Hill AFB F-105D Skins
The 466th TFS, USAF Reserve, was lhe last operator of the F-105 Thunderchief. They flew their last mission before converting to the F-16A in 1984. Due to how
long they flew the 'Thud' and their proximity to Ogden Air Logistics Center, where many aircraft go to be repainted, they flew 3 Thuds in colors other than the traditional SEA camo. Those schemes (SEA Wraparound, European 1, and a one off Desert scheme based on the pattern of the first two) are represented here.
Also provided are black tailcode for the 466th ('HI') and 50 black serial numbers. Sorry only 50 as the Thud was getting rarer by that time. The first 10 serials are
historical with the first 3 being the ones used by the aircraft so painted. the other
40 numbers are redone TW serials spanning FY59-62.
This is not a completely accurate rendition, the pattern is different than T.O. 1-1-4
states for SEA Wraparound and Euro 1. What I did was to wraparound the stock skin, then
swap the colors (as was done IRL). I also did not do the nose art's for the aircraft
due to other commmitments, and lack of time.

SF2 WW2 PB4Y-1 (B-24D) USN Liberator, ETO Pak by Veltro2K
By Wrench
SF2 WW2 PB4Y-1 (B-24D) USN Liberator, ETO Pak by Veltro2K 4/28/2014
(Full 4/5 Merged Reccomended)
**Having a merged install is reccomended, as the destroyed model references the stock 3W An-12's destroyed lod.**
This pack contains a NEW aircrft, by Veltro2k; the US Navy's PB4Y-1 (B-24D) Liberator as seen in the Atlantic theatre (both North & South). This aircraft uses some SF2NA 'mission statements'.
It is designed for use =ONLY= in the North Atlantic/ETO. Research has not turned up any data about USN "D" models being used in SoWesPac or CenPac. Or in the Med.
The unit represented herein are:
VPB-105, as based in the UK.
The aircraft is finished in "Atlantic Sea Search" camo, and while 'assigned' to VPB-105, is representative of pretty much all USN VPB Liberator units as seen from Iceland to Brazil, and all points in between.
The skins are in jpg format. All markings are decals (excepting the wing national markings). The BuNums are 'generic' in nature, as they represent no particular aircraft within a specific unit, but ARE for the model variant depicted. Decal randomization is set to TRUE. There are NO nose arts.

SF2 WW2 SB2C-1 Helldiver Tweeks Pak
By Wrench
SF2 WW2 SB2C-1 Helldiver Tweeks Pak
-- Something for the PTO players --
= For SF2, Full-5 Merged (Reccomended/Preferred) =
Some tweeks, and a new skin for Veltro2K's recently released Curtiss SB2C-1 "Helldiver" WW2 USN dive bomber. It is to be applied to the aircraft package available at the following url:
http://combatace.com/files/file/13772-curtiss-sb2c-1-helldiver/
This pak contains a brand new 3-tone camo skin and 'generic' modex number decal set. The skin iteself can be also considered generic, as all units, when the Helldiver first entered service, were painted in the 3-tone. Some, including -3 & -4 models, carried it until VJ-Day. However, after late 43/early 44, the "G" system of Air Group marking came into being. This pak does NOT contain any G-system markings. They can easily be added via decals ini tweeking.
